Job Description

What to Expect

As a I&E Design Technician you will be playing a critical role in the construction of our clients first lithium refinery plant near Corpus Christi, TX. This role will require collaboration across functional groups to resolve technical design issues, ensure quality installations, track and report cost/schedule metrics, and model safe work practices. This is a role that requires sound technical judgement and creative problem-solving skills to support field operations.

Day to Day

  • Manage and answer Request for Information (RFI) submissions from contractors
  • Support internal QA team with inspections and Non-Compliance Reports (NCRs)
  • Identify and provide a path of resolution to design technical field issues as they arise in collaboration with engineering, applicable contractors, and other parties as required
  • Support Project Mangers (PMs) with cost controlling, scheduling, engineering deliverable reviews & tracking, and similar
  • Support with development/review of contractor bid packages including project scopes of work, cost estimates, work plans, and resource requirements
  • Evaluate contractor change orders and provide recommendations to project management
  • Support safety by creating reports, managing the resolution, and implementing changes to any unsafe work conditions
  • Ensure all field activities are being executed per project specifications, procedures, and current design documents
  • Create, revise, and execute site specific standards and support in the creation of specifications for your area of expertise
  • Review and implement codes and regulations for your area of expertise
  • Complete constructability reviews and provide feedback to the appropriate teams for lessons learns and proactive fixes in the field
  • Complete reviews on calculations and supplemental documentation with feedback on improving designs along with cost reduction where possible

Requirements

  • 5-15 years of relevant industrial experience (heavy industrial, oil & gas, complex chemical plants)
  • Instrumentation and Electrical Background
  • Instrumentation (level transmitters, alarms, thermal couples, etc.)
  • Electrical load list, cable schedules, single line diagrams, cable tray routing, underground duct bank & conduit, grounding, and lighting plans
  • Piping and Instrumentation Diagram (P&ID), Process Flow Diagram (PFD), Process Hazard Analysis (PHA), heat tracing, process data sheets, and instrument cut sheets
  • Going through models and design deliverables for technical reviews & constructability
  • Review and procuring for any request within your discipline – generating POs from bids
  • Previous experience on $200M+ projects, preferably with experience on both “owner” and “contractor” side
  • Ability to read and interpret construction drawings and technical specifications
  • Preferred Software: Navisworks, Bluebeam, AutoCAD
  • Proven ability to identify field issues and propose efficient solutions
  • Willingness to spend a high percentage of time in the field and to get hands dirty as needed to complete objectives or find the correct information
  • Ability to work within a high-performance, cross-functional organization with extremely tight timelines and aggressive goal
  • Excellent written and verbal communication, presentation skills are a must

Plusses

  • Degree in Engineering or similar
  • Experience in both greenfield and brownfield construction environments
  • E/I/C drafting & redlining experience preferred
